Hi,
why is ESRI Geodatabase not supported in 64 bit version? I take it I need to download the 32 bit for it to work?
Are there any plans to amend that in future versions and include the 64bit as well or are the two incompatible by default?

The Esri software functions that we use to read the geodatabase are only supplied as 32-bit versions, and are not compatible with a 64-bit application. These functions require that you have a valid Esri license. You have to use these functions if you are reading an ArcSDE database, or a File Geodatabase created with an ArcGIS version before version 10, or raster data from any geodatabase.
If you are trying to read vector features from a File Geodatabase created with ArcGIS 10 or later, or a Personal Geodatabase (.mdb file) then you can read it using either 32-bit or 64-bit Global Mapper, and you don't need an Esri license.
I am sorry this is so confusing, but this is due to Esri licensing issues, and is not under our control.
